Seeing how far I can take my body. One day I would like to compete for the fun of it to see were I place, but that will not be for some time.I want to add more size to my legs.I have 26 thighs and only 16 1/2 calf's want to get my thighs up to 30.I started with 20's so I think I can add 4 more inches in two years.I really hit them hard.

I go real heavy on Saturday's and light and high rep on Tuesday.I'm trying something new with my calf's to see if that will help them grow.I do 8 reps of calf raises with a 2 second hold at top an bottom and then a ten second rest then I jump up and down with a 1/4 of my body weight on a barbell 30 times.

Just started so I hope I get some gains out of this routine will see. (I do this super set four times)I plane to do three times a week.I got this routine off T-Nation.I will post picture of the progress.(big calf's do run in the family my brother and son have nice calf's.It is just that I neglected them when I was young big mistake but nothing hard work can not cure.

Let me know what you think of this super set calf routine (I only had an inch an half gain in four years on my calf's so I need something new. what I been doing isn't getting me enough gains as I should. I feel I should of had more gains in my calf's
